India’s EV Boom in 2026: What’s Driving It?

India’s electric revolution is not accidental—it’s a mix of economics, policy, and evolving consumer mindset.

Quick Answer:

  • EV running cost: ₹1–₹1.5/km vs ₹6–₹10/km (petrol)

  • Maintenance cost: Up to 40% lower

  • Government subsidies: Available under FAME and state policies

Why EV adoption is accelerating:

  • Rising fuel prices

  • Strong government incentives

  • Expanding charging network

  • Better battery range (300–500 km now common)

Top EVs Driving India’s Sustainable Future (Best Models in 2026)

1. Tata Nexon EV (Still the Benchmark)

India’s best-selling electric SUV continues to dominate.

Why it stands out:

  • Real-world range: 300–450 km

  • Fast charging support

  • Strong service network

Best for: Families + long-distance occasional travel

2. Tata Punch EV (Mass Market Game-Changer)

Affordable, compact, and practical—this is where EV adoption is exploding.

Key highlights:

  • Budget-friendly pricing

  • Ideal for city driving

  • Modern infotainment & safety

Best for: First-time EV buyers

3. MG ZS EV (Premium Experience)

A feature-loaded SUV for buyers upgrading to electric.

Top features:

  • ADAS safety tech

  • Premium interior

  • Smooth driving experience

Best for: Tech-savvy urban users

4. Mahindra XUV400 (Performance + Space)

Mahindra’s serious push into EVs.

Why consider it:

  • Strong acceleration

  • Spacious cabin

  • Competitive pricing

5. Citroën eC3 (Budget Urban EV)

Simple, practical, and affordable.

Best for:

  • Daily commuting

  • Short city drives

Quick Comparison Table

ModelRange (km)SegmentBest Use Case
Tata Nexon EV300–450Compact SUVFamily + highway
Tata Punch EV250–350Micro SUVCity driving
MG ZS EV400+Premium SUVComfort + tech
XUV400350–400SUVPerformance + space
Citroën eC3200–300HatchbackBudget commuting

Real Benefits of EV Ownership (Beyond Fuel Savings)

1. Massive Cost Savings

Electric cars can save ₹50,000–₹1 lakh annually on fuel alone.

2. Lower Maintenance

No engine oil, fewer moving parts = fewer breakdowns.

3. Silent & Smooth Driving

Near-zero noise and instant torque make EVs more enjoyable.

4. Tech-First Experience

  • OTA updates

  • Smart dashboards

  • Connected apps

Challenges (And What’s Improving)

Charging Infrastructure

  • Still growing in Tier 2/3 cities

  • Rapid highway expansion underway

High Initial Cost

  • Gradually reducing with local manufacturing

Range Anxiety

  • Now mostly solved with 300+ km range EVs

Future of EVs in India: What to Expect

  • Battery prices will drop further

  • 500+ km range EVs will become common

  • Charging stations will be as common as petrol pumps

  • EV resale market will stabilize

India is expected to become one of the top 3 EV markets globally by 2030.
